Responsibilities

Summary:
The Compliance Administrator at US Immigration and Customs Enforcement facilities is a supervisory position that serves as the facility’s subject matter expert on all compliance and accreditation issues. Develops, maintains, and revises all assessment instruments to monitor the success of a facility’s compliance activities. Develops reports for management regarding the facility’s compliance and accreditation areas. Recommends process improvements, as necessary. Solely accountable for communicating rules, regulations, and guidelines to all impacted areas throughout the facility.

May be assigned to projects that may impact the region or organization.

This position also serves as the facility’s liaison regarding the interpretation of all compliance and accreditation policies and guidelines. Finally, this position acts on behalf of the organization when compliance and accreditation audits occur.

Primary Duties and Responsibilities:

  • The Compliance Administrator reviews and assesses all functional areas within the facility to identify compliance issues. Documents reviews through formalized reports with an assessment of the issues and recommendations for improvement.
  • Develops effective instruments to determine whether departments are in compliance.
  • The Compliance Administrator meets with department managers to determine whether the area is in compliance with the organization, contracting client, or outside party. When non-compliant, partners with department managers to develop strategies to gain compliance.
  • Serves as the facility’s subject matter expert in the area of interpreting the compliance and accreditation criteria based on organization, contracting client, or outside party requirements.

    The Compliance Administrator validates that the facility’s policies and procedures are in compliance with organizational, contracting clients, or outside party’s guidelines.
  • Performs facility level operational reviews and audits of all functional areas as required by a published schedule, accurately reporting any findings of noncompliance, and recommending appropriate corrective actions.
  • Collects and reports to a compliance or accreditation party.
